Vietnam team is about to face a world-class goalkeeper who used to play in the Premier League.

Báo Thanh niênBáo Thanh niên06/11/2023


The Vietnam team will compete against the Philippines at Rizal Memorial Stadium on November 16, in the opening match of the second qualifying round for the 2026 World Cup.

Compared to the Vietnamese, Thai, Malaysian or Indonesian teams, the Philippine team has fallen behind in recent years when they are often eliminated early in the AFF Cup and World Cup qualifiers. However, the team nicknamed "The Azkals" is still very formidable, with stars playing in Europe in the squad. The most notable of which is goalkeeper Neil Etheridge.

Born in 1990, with Filipino blood, Neil Etheridge has spent his entire career playing football in England. The 33-year-old goalkeeper spent time as an intern at Chelsea's youth academy, before moving to Fulham and starting his professional career.

In his 15 years of playing since the beginning of his career until now, Neil Etheridge has played for a series of English teams, mainly in the lower group in the Premier League such as Fulham, or playing in the first and second division such as Cardiff City, Birmingham City, Walsall, Oldham Athletic or Charlton Athletic.

Neil Etheridge's greatest achievement in his career was winning promotion to the Premier League with Cardiff City in 2018. The Filipino goalkeeper played very consistently in the English First Division with 45 appearances (out of a total of 46 matches), helping Cardiff City finish second with 39 goals conceded (the fewest in the league).

Neil Etheridge's spectacular saves and sure-footed timing helped the Welsh team overcome a series of strong teams to reach the Premier League.

Although Cardiff City had to take the "reverse train" to the first division after only 1 season in the Premier League, Neil Etheridge was still highly appreciated with 38 appearances and many impressive saves. This was also the only season that the Filipino goalkeeper played in the highest division of England.

Neil Etheridge is playing for Birmingham City

Neil Etheridge then moved to Birmingham City and is in his fifth season with the central English team.

However, this goalkeeper only played in the first season, before being briefly demoted to Birmingham's youth team, and when he returned he was only a backup to the main goalkeeper John Ruddy. This season, Neil Etheridge has not played a single match.

Interestingly, the Philippines goalkeeper is currently being coached by Wayne Rooney. The former Manchester United player was appointed to lead Birmingham at the end of October, alongside the new coaching staff including Ashley Cole, the famous former defender who played for Chelsea and the England national team.

Back to his national team career. Although he has been playing for the Philippines since 2008, Neil Etheridge has only played 46 matches for "The Azkals" in the past 15 years, which is an average of 3 matches per year, which is relatively few.

The problem is not Neil Etheridge's talent, but because this goalkeeper plays in England, while the tournaments that the Philippine team participates in such as the AFF Cup, Asian Cup. These tournaments take place at the end and beginning of the calendar year, this is also the time when the competition schedule in the Premier League or English First Division is the most dense and fierce.

That is why Neil Etheride rarely plays for the national team. He only plays in certain matches when the Philippine Football Federation convinces his club to release him.

Neil Etheridge is the fulcrum of the Philippines

However, Neil Etheridge had a chance to face the Vietnamese team at the AFF Cup 2010. At My Dinh Stadium 13 years ago in a group stage match, Neil Etheridge's flying moves helped the Philippines to a shocking 2-0 victory over defending champions Vietnam.

After 13 years, Neil Etheridge is no longer a 20-year-old talent. The Philippine goalkeeper is now 33 years old, a number considered "mature" for a goalkeeper. He also accumulated a lot of experience during his time playing in the foggy country.

Neil Etheridge's class and talent will be the fulcrum for the Philippines to stand firm against the Vietnamese team on November 16, when the two teams compete on the artificial turf of Rizal Memorial.
